Back to Directory
Creek Road Rentals LLC
388 Starrucca Creek Rd, Susquehanna, PA 18847
5.0(4 reviews)
Location
Loading map…
388 Starrucca Creek Rd, Susquehanna, PA 18847
Equipment Available
Contact Information
- Phone
- +1 570-727-2408
- Website
- www.creekroadrentals.com/
- Location
- Susquehanna, PA
Hours
- Monday
- Closed
- Tuesday
- Closed
- Wednesday
- 10AM-3PM
- Thursday
- 10AM-3PM
- Friday
- 10AM-3PM
- Saturday
- 10AM-12PM
- Sunday
- Closed
Send a Message
Get a quote or ask about availability directly.
Customer Reviews
5.0
4 reviews
Write a Review
Rented from Creek Road Rentals LLC? Share your experience.